Explore the natural beauty of Bullock-Pens Park in Pittsburgh, PA! This hidden gem offers two distinct hiking experiences perfect for outdoor enthusiasts of all levels. Choose the 3-mile Bullock-Pens Outer Loop Trail for a moderate challenge, accessible right from the main parking lot on Beulah Rd. The trail features a mix of paved and uneven surfaces, including a hilly northern section. Although formal viewpoints are absent, you'll enjoy scenic views of the park, surrounding hills, and charming neighborhoods. Be sure to check conditions before traversing the aging bridge on the outer loop, and pack accordingly if you plan to utilize the small creek as a water source.
For a shorter and easier hike, opt for the 1.3-mile Bullock-Pens Inner Loop Trail. This dog-friendly loop is perfect for a quick nature escape and connects the park's main parking lots. Enjoy elevated perspectives of the park and the winding creeks below as you stroll along this family-friendly path.
